Abstract
Clustering is an important phase in data mining. A number of different clustering methods are used to perform cluster analysis: Partitioning Clustering, hierarchical clustering, grid-based clustering, model-based, graph based clustering and density based clustering and so on. Hierarchical method helps us to cluster the data objects in the form of a tree known as hierarchy. And each node in hierarchy is known as the cluster. Hierarchical clustering can be performed in two ways: agglomerative clustering and divisive clustering. Agglomerative clustering is always more preferable. For a good cluster analysis, the quality of the clusters should be high. In this paper, we will measure the quality of clusters with the help of three parameters: Cohesion measurement, Silhouette index and Elapsed time.
